Chain-free extended three-bedroom detached house
This extended three-bedroom detached house on Frensham Drive offers practical family living with useful additional space and good transport links. The ground floor includes a generous lounge/diner, separate dining room, kitchen, utility room and downstairs cloakroom — useful for busy households. The garage, driveway and decent front and rear gardens add storage and off-road parking convenience.
Positioned close to Bletchley train station and local amenities, the home is offered chain-free and is well suited to commuters seeking straightforward access to London. Built in the late 1970s/early 1980s, the property benefits from double glazing and gas central heating, but some updating is likely to personalise and modernise interiors.
Practical considerations: there is one family bathroom upstairs and a medium flood risk for the area, which buyers should factor into insurance and resilience planning. Walls are cavity construction with assumed partial insulation; thicker insulation or energy upgrades may be worthwhile investments to improve comfort and running costs.
Overall this is a sensible family home with scope to add value through cosmetic and energy-efficiency improvements, available with no onward chain and a layout that suits everyday family life and commuting needs.
